Casey Elliott, RVT, VTS (ECC)
Casey graduated from Bel-Rea in 2011 and launched into her career head first with a special interest in emergency medicine. In 2019 she obtained the National Veterinary Associates CVT of the year award as well as the Above and Beyond award for her work within and outside of the veterinary community promoting animal welfare. In early 2021, after working through a pandemic alongside her fellow healthcare heroes, Casey became an ad hoc volunteer with the CACVT and helped launch the campaign for technician title protection that was accepted into Colorado law in 2023. With her passion for emergency medicine, Casey obtained her VTS (ECC) in late 2023 and has goals of bringing advanced education to the next generation of vet techs. She believes in driving individual growth among veterinary personnel and educating the community to advance the field.
Sandra Engelmeyer, BS, RVT, VTS (Surgery)
Sandra completed her Bachelor of Science in Animal Science from Iowa State University in 2009. In 2010 she completed her Associate of Applied Science in Veterinary Technology and became a licensed veterinary technician. She completed an ECC internship at the University of Minnesota Veterinary Medical Center. After two years in general medicine, Saundra returned to ECC as an ICU technician with BluePearl Pet Hospital. In 2014 she transferred to the specialty surgery department within BluePearl Pet Hospital and became a VTS (Surgery) in 2019. In 2020, Sandra became the ACCESS Bone & Joint Center department lead in Culver City, CA until 2023. She currently is working at Spry Companions, a dedicated orthopedic surgical practice, as the primary scrub technician for Dr. von Pfeil. Saundra serves on the board for the Academy of Veterinary Surgical Technicians, is a faculty instructor with Arthrex and AOVet, and presents at conferences.
